Kitchen Water Damage Restoration Cost in Silverlake, TX

The cost of kitchen water damage restoration in Silverlake, TX can vary depending on the severity and size of the damage. Here are some estimated costs for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water removal and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Cabinet repair and restoration $1,000 – $5,000 Size of cabinets, type of material
Appliance repair and restoration $500 – $2,000 Type of appliance, extent of damage
Wall repair and restoration $1,000 – $5,000 Size of wall, type of material
Professional cleaning and disinfection $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of surface

Common Questions About Kitchen Water Damage Restoration

What causes kitchen water damage?

Kitchen water damage can be caused by a variety of factors, including burst pipes, overflowing dishwashers, and leaky faucets. It’s essential to address the problem quickly to prevent further damage.
